mysql обновляет столбец с помощью int на основе порядка

Допустим, у меня есть эти столбцы

 uniqueID|Money|Quantity|MoneyOrder|QuantityOrder
1|23|12||
2|11|9||
3|99|100||

. Я хочу обновить MoneyOrderи QuantityOrderна основе значения ORDER BY.

Таким образом, результаты будут такими::

uniqueID|Money|Quantity|MoneyOrder|QuantityOrder
1|23|12|2|1
2|11|90|1|2
3|99|100|3|3

Я хочу, чтобы обновление работало как столбец идентификаторов, фактически не превращая его в столбец идентификаторов. Я знаю, что могу просто заказать по «x», и заказ будет результатом, но я хочу создать отчет, в котором вы можете видеть элемент построчно.

Возможно ли подобное update mytable set Moneyorder = 'imnotsure' order by MoneyOrder asc?

8
задан Salman A 24 November 2016 в 15:30
поделиться